India Inc. Hiring activity dips for all sectors in August,13 - says Naukri Job Speak Index Naukri Jobspeak
5% increase witnessed in hiring in August when compared to last year
All the top metros have witnessed dip in hiring levels, indicating caution in the business and recruiting environment.
Hiring was subdued among majority of sectors. Auto, Telecom & Pharma index has gone down in the range of
13% to 15% in Aug'13 over July'13.
Most of the sectors showing dip in demand for professionals across sectors when compared to previous month.

The BYOD Mobile Security Threat is Real
Paul Luehr knows a thing or two about security, the law and "Bring Your Own Device," or BYOD. Formerly a federal prosecutor and supervisor of the Internet fraud program at the Federal Trade Commission, Luehr is a managing director at Stroz Friedberg, a global data risk management company with a cyber-crime lab. He focuses on computer forensics, ...

What Google Trends Say About IT Firms
Google Trends hit the headlines late last month when three academics - Tobias Preis, Helen Susannah Moat and H. Eugene Stanley - published a paper that said "Google Trends data did not only reflect the current state of the stock markets but may have also been able to anticipate certain future trends."
